The Position
The Department of Safety Assessment at Genentech providesscientific leadership and plays an active role in the process of drugdevelopment from late-stage discovery through marketed products. We are seeking an Associate Scientist/Scientist in the Department of Safety Assessment to supportdrug discovery and development. This role will involve working in acollaborative team environment as part of the comprehensive safety assessmentof Genentech therapeutics by providing discovery and investigative toxicologysupport to early stage small molecule research programs.
Responsibilities
Proactive risk assessment ofpotential toxicity issues related to undesired or exaggerated pharmacology,investigation or characterization of potential toxicity issues to enable smallmolecule lead optimization and candidate nomination.
In this role, the toxicologist willprovide representation to discovery project teams, which will include safetytarget assessments, strategic planning and designing, implementing andsupervising toxicology studies in support of compound lead optimization(e.g. in vitro toxicity screening, counter-assay development) and mechanisticinvestigations (development of hypothesis-driven research plans, in vitro or invivo model development and qualification, and scientific projectmanagement). This position will include staff supervision as needed andcontributing to the continued refinement of lead optimization andinvestigational strategies and identification of new technologies. Thediscovery toxicologist will interact closely with research scientists andSafety Assessment development toxicologists and pathologists to ensure thatdiscovery teams consider all of the appropriate strategic needs for candidateidentification with regard to toxicology issues, thus providing bettercandidate selection and characterization of toxicology issues at the time oftransition to early development.
